MEMO — Heads of Department

Heads up: we're moving ahead with the price increase for legacy Bramleaf subscribers — 8% starting next quarter. Grandfathered rates end after that. Comms will send customer notices in three waves; support should expect some noise. Please brief your teams before Monday and route escalations through Retention, not billing. The confidential business note is appended directly below:

board note of bawep-tajef: Queniusek Systems plans to raise the Quenvan list price by 53.1 percent in March. The pricing group signed off on a budget of $176.4 million for Project Drueth. The renewal with Casionix Partners closes at $142.5 million a year, 8.3 percent below the last contract. Project Fraax slips by six weeks because of the tooling delay.

Heads up before we cut the release: the thumbnail queue in Snapcrate was starving large uploads because the worker pool and retry backoff were tuned for the old Ferris cluster. I rebalanced them after profiling Tuesday's spike — throughput is up ~40% with no timeout regressions. Nothing else in this diff matters much. The new values the workers pick up are these.

tuning table, kajog-kawef:
PRIORITIES = {
    "kelox": 870,
    "kasix": 89,
    "eliax": 988,
}

TICKET #—Missed pick-up, Brindle Reservoir water samples. Courier from Quillhart Transit never arrived at Bay 3 yesterday. Samples are chilled and hold until tomorrow noon, no later. Re-book with priority flag and confirm the driver checks in at the dock office first. The hand-over instruction for the replacement courier is as follows:

handover note for yagef-bagep: the drudor pelius courier leaves the kasdor zorvan norir ledger at gate 8016 under passcode 755406

## Deploy Step 4 — Givnote Mailer

Givnote sends donation receipts for the Harrowfield Trust portal. Build the container from the mailer directory. Run the smoke test against the sandbox SMTP relay first; production sends are irreversible. Config lives in .env on the deploy host: GIVNOTE_FROM_NAME, GIVNOTE_BATCH_SIZE, GIVNOTE_RETRY_MAX. Do not edit templates on the host — they ship with the image. The relay rejects unauthenticated senders, so the relay credential must be present. Append it on the next line of the env file.

sealed setting: ARCHIVE_KEY3=8d0